In today’s challenging times, with organisations and individuals increasingly under pressure to perform better – often with less resource – increased levels of conflict are inevitable. And conflict in the workplace, if left unaddressed, leads to poor productivity, low morale, sickness, absence and increased levels of grievance and employment tribunals. This London based course will explore the key principles that underpin mediation and you will learn how to incorporate mediation skills into your everyday managerial practice as well as experience mediating a real life workplace conflict.

The course covers:

  • the most common causes of conflict in your organisation/department
  • understanding reactions to conflict and how conflict escalates
  • the key principles of mediation
  • understanding how to set up and run a mediation
  • practising the advanced communication skills used by mediators
  • how to stay impartial
  • principled negotation
  • how to facilitate a consensual approach to problem solving
  • how to help parties find their own solutions
  • when to mediate – and when not to
  • how to make the case internally for mediation

This two-day course is especially useful for managers at all levels who want to understand how to use mediation techniques to resolve interpersonal conflict quickly and effectively. The course is also relevant to anyone with responsibility for helping individuals resolve conflict such as HR professionals or union representatives.

The Centre works with people from all sectors including the public sector, voluntary sector, private sector and corporate sector.

After attending this course, you will know when and how to mediate low level conflicts at work. By identifying and addressing problems early, you will be able to help save time and money by avoiding costly, stressful and time consuming grievances and employment tribunals.
